Ackley Student Loan Debt Consolidation Benefits
Student loan consolidation is most beneficial for Stafford loans disbursed between July 1, 1998 and June 30, 2006 that have variable interest rates. If you have fixed rate loans issued after that date, you may not be able to reduce the rate much by consolidating, but it will still simplify your payments. The federal student loan rate resets each July 1 and the new rate is announced in the spring. If you have federal loans, you can consolidate all your loans to lock-in a fixed rate and extend your repayment term.
Most loan companies also offer a small interest rate reduction for automatic payments and an additional reduction after 24-36 on-time payments. Although you must apply by June 30 to qualify for this year's rate, most lenders will postpone the final consolidation until your repayment grace period expires. The grace period is usually 6-9 months.
Reasons to Think Twice About Ackley Student Loan Debt Consolidation
Its not beneficial for you if you apply for student debt consolidation when your balances are below $10,000. Especially, if you are close to paying off your loans, you might end up paying more interest when you applying for consolidation. If you have to combine them with a spouse's loans in order to qualify, student debt consolidation does not help either. At the time of your demise, your loans are forgiven, but your spouse would still be under obligation to pay the full consolidated balance if you combine your loans into one. If you are unable to make your home loan payments due to the additional cost of student loans rolled into the balance, you have a very good chance of losing your home.
Who Qualifies for Ackley Student Loan Debt Consolidation
Once you decide you would like to consolidate your student loans, the best course of action is to start shopping around for lenders. If you have graduated and have $10,000 or more in student loan debt, it should be very easy for you to consolidate. The Federal government's website has a list of consolidation lenders and you can find lenders online. Some lenders will consolidate loans up to $3,500 and even consolidate loans that you have defaulted on, but you may be offered a high interest rate. Look at how consolidating will affect your finances long term and decide who offers you the best deal and whether consolidating is still good for you. You can even consolidate while you are still in school, but you forfeit your interest deferral, so you want to examine the long-term impact on your finances from doing so.
